Fresh Kimchi Spring Rolls
Fresh Kimchi Spring Rolls
8 servings

These creamy, tangy, and fresh kimchi spring rolls are the ultimate chilled appetizer for any party or potluck!

Ingredients
1/3 cup soy sauce ($0.26)
1/3 cup rice wine vinegar ($1.44)
1 Tbsp sesame oil ($0.32)
1 Tbsp sriracha ($0.25)
1 minced green onion ($0.10)
1 minced garlic clove ($0.05)
1 inch ginger, peeled and grated ($0.15)
1 cup kimchi ($2.99)
1 cup roasted unsalted peanuts ($1.24)
2 Tbsp peanut butter ($0.12)
1 Tbsp maple syrup ($0.31)
2 Tbsp toasted sesame oil ($0.64)
2 bell peppers, julienned ($2.98)
2 carrots, julienned ($0.18)
1 cucumber, seeded and julienned ($0.82)
1 head green leaf lettuce, cut into 2-inch pieces ($1.97)
1 package spring roll rice paper wrappers ($1.46)
Instructions
1 Combine the soy sauce, rice wine vinegar, sriracha, grated ginger, and garlic in a mixing bowl. Whisk together and stream sesame oil in very slowly while whisking to emulsify. Stir in green onions and set dipping sauce aside.
2 Add kimchi, peanuts, peanut butter, maple, and toasted sesame oil to a food processor.
3 Pulse until a thick, chunky, well-combined paste forms. Texture is a good thing, so don’t process it to the point of being smooth. Set aside in the fridge.
4 Julienne bell peppers, carrots, cucumber, and cut green leaf lettuce into 2 inch pieces.
5 Fill a shallow cookie sheet with warm water next to a clean cutting board or other suitable, clean work surface.
6 Dip the edible spring roll wrapper in the shallow warm water until soft and pliable, but not overly mushy.
7 Transfer to your clean work surface and carefully fill the spring roll wrapper with lettuce on the bottom, a 1-2 Tablespoon scoop of kimchi filling in the middle, a few julienned veggies and another piece of lettuce on top.**
8 Gently wrap each spring roll, tucking in the sides to keep all of the filling from falling out.
9 Sprinkle each spring roll with sesame seeds (optional, but they add a nice texture and help keep the finished rolls from sticking together and tearing.)
10 Repeat steps 5-8 until all of your filling is used up.
11 Serve fresh kimchi spring rolls cut in half with dipping sauce. Enjoy!
